The chemoenzymatic synthesis of usnic acid

Bioorg Med Chem Lett. 2009 May 1;19(9):2383-5. doi: 10.1016/j.bmcl.2009.03.087. Epub 2009 Mar 26.

Abstract

Usnic acid, a highly functionalized dibenzofuran, is a polyketide secondary metabolite produced by several species of lichens. Synthesis of usnic acid from commercially available starting material was accomplished in two steps. The synthesis involves the methylation of phloracetophenone followed by oxidation with horseradish peroxidase. This work will lay the foundation for further biosynthetic studies on usnic acid.
